Our Sunbury based client is seeking an Experienced Project Manager to lead the delivery of major, technically complex construction projects within their division. Salary up to £48,000. This role sits within Operations and focuses on project execution, programme control, cost management, quality assurance, and stakeholder coordination across internal teams and external partners. Key Responsibilities: • Take ownership of the full project life cycle following order acceptance, from technical clearance through to installation completion and handover., • Act as the primary operational point of contact for assigned projects., • Coordinate internal teams including technical clearance, procurement, manufacturing, logistics, and installation, • Monitor project progress against programme, product lead times, and contractual requirements., • Proactively manage project programmes, identifying risks, constraints, and dependencies., • Act as the first point of escalation for site-based operational and quality issues., • Attend site as required to support installations, resolve issues, and maintain delivery momentum., • Ensure installations are delivered in line with quality standards and customer expectations., • Work alongside Regional Operations Manager to ensure site is ready for installation., • Identify and address margin erosion arising from defects, rework, or programme delays, • Monitor and control project-level costs, including:, • Field Operations Costs (FOPs), • Late and abortive costs, • Subcontractor costs and invoicing, • Project stock and Work in Progress (WIP)KNOWLEDGE / SKILLS / EXPERIENCE REQUIREDEssential, • Proven experience as a Project Manager within the construction, building services, or engineered systems sector., • Experience managing multi-stakeholder, technically complex projects., • Strong commercial awareness and cost control experience., • Ability to manage programmes, risk, and delivery under pressure., • Confident communicator with strong written and verbal skills., • Experience working with ERP systems (SAP experience advantageous)., • Strong organisational and prioritisation skills., • Competent user of Microsoft Office.
